Express Entry Education Section Help Required
Hi All
I joined the site a long while ago after what was a normal fortnightly skype chat with my brother in law turned into a lengthy discussion with my wife about the possibility of us moving to be close to her brother. We made our first visit to see them last year and we both fell in love with the place and decided this could be somewhere we want to live and bring up our 2 children so we feel now is the time to start the ball rolling to see if this is possible.
I am planning to go through the express entry route as long as i am eligible and planning to do the IELTS test next month which will give me the grades to fill in the eligiblity test .I do have a couple of questions which i am hoping someone can please help on is which section to select on the Education selection and which certificates if any i need to have assessed. The first ones are what i achieved for school and college over the years.
1. Completed High School with 7 GCSE`s ( These are not the highest of grades)
2. Completed Diploma in Public Services
3. 2 x short evening courses at local college ( IT Related)
4. 1 year course split into 2 Semesters ( IT Related)
I have also take a number of courses and exams which related to what i do now which is in the IT industry so are generally Cisco & Microsoft certifications which i believe are recognised worldwide so not sure if these would need to be assessed?

Re: Express Entry Education Section Help Required
HI
1, You would have to get your highest educational achievement assessed by one of the accredited companies by CIC. IMHO the one you would have assessed is the Diploma in PUblic services. You could include the 1 year to see what it was assessed at. Cisco and Microsoft certifications are not considered a educational accomplishments, but industry certifications.
